Can I Take Montelukast for a Cold? Separating Allergy from Viral Illness

Studies have shown that montelukast does not reduce the incidence of upper respiratory tract infections caused by viruses. For this reason, the answer to the common question, "Can I take montelukast for a cold?", is no, as this prescription medication is designed to target inflammation from conditions like asthma and allergies, not viral illnesses.
